About the images. Thanks. I do enjoy tinkering with the 'raw' images taken in the games. I take them pretty much the way I would with a camera - frame and focus - and then bring them into the 'digital darkroom' of Photoshop. There, I try to turn them into what I saw in my imagination. Sometimes more than my original vision. I am grateful for your appreciation and for calling my work 'art'.

I've seen explosions of extinguishers and tanks before but this one behaved differently. Instead of exploding with a big bang, the gas acted like a propellant sending the unexploded tank bouncing around the room like letting letting go of an air filled balloon rather than popping it. Is that how that oxygen tank launcher works? I've seen it before but never really figured out how to launch the tanks. Anyway, I've wanted to post that image for a while.
